In December, Toronto proudly hosted Tilt-Up Nexus: Advancing Canadian Construction, a significant event for the Tilt-Up Concrete Association (TCA) in Canada and the first major TCA assembly in the country since 2017.
Guided by the Canadian Advisory Board, Tilt-Up Nexus created a platform for initiating collaborations, forming partnerships, and incubating innovations that pave the way forward for the tilt-up construction industry in Canada.

The day featured sessions from industry experts on a variety of topics, including affordable housing, low carbon concrete solutions, and an exploration of tilt-up construction myths. The event concluded with a lively networking reception at the Universal Event Space in Vaughan, Ontario.

The TCA is pleased to announce that the second iteration of Tilt-Up Nexus is planned for 2024, with the location in Canada to be determined by the advisory board. Further details will be available on the TCA website as they develop.
